Abstract

The Department of Health and Human Services owns US Patent 6630507 which states that cannabinoids are powerful
antioxidants and have the potential to treat myriad ischemic, age-related, inflammatory, and auto-immune disorders. The
patent claims cannabinoids are also a natural neuroprotectant which could help treat neurological damage caused by
stroke and trauma, as well as other neurological disorders like Alzheimer’s, Parkinson’s Disease, and Multiple Sclerosis.
This perspective paper assesses the properties and usefulness of the patented cannabinoid.
